Ion irradiation induced enhancement of out-of-plane magnetic anisotropy in ultrathin Co films

Ga+ or He+ irradiated MBE grown ultrathin films of sapphire/Pt/Co (d Co)/Pt (d Pt) were
studied using polar Kerr effect in wide ranges of both cobalt d Co and platinum d Pt
thicknesses as well as ion fluences F. Two branches of increased magnetic anisotropy and
enhanced Kerr rotation angle induced by Ga+ or He+ irradiation are clearly visible in two-
dimensional (d Co, LogF) diagrams. Only Ga+ irradiation induces two branches of out-of-
plane magnetization state.
